252-4220-00L | A Taste of Research: Algorithms and Combinatorics | 2 credits | 2S | B. Gärtner, J. Matousek, A. Steger, E. Welzl, P. Widmayer | |
Abstract | Students work together with lecturers on open problems in algorithms and combinatorics. | ||||
Learning objective | The goal is to learn and practice important research techniques: literature search, understanding and presenting research papers, developing ideas in the group, testing of conjectures with the computer, writing down results. | ||||
Content | Work on original research papers and open problems in the areas of algorithms and combinatorics. | ||||
